--- Comment #9 from Eric Botcazou <ebotcazou at gcc dot gnu.org> 2012-06-15 09:22:04 UTC --- Author: ebotcazou Date: Fri Jun 15 09:22:00 2012 New Revision: 188651 URL: http://gcc.gnu.org/viewcvs?root=gcc&view=rev&rev=188651 Log: PR middle-end/53590 * common.opt (-fdelete-dead-exceptions): New switch. * doc/invoke.texi (Code Gen Options): Document it. * cse.c (count_reg_usage) <CALL_INSN>: Use !insn_nothrow_p in lieu of insn_could_throw_p predicate. Do not skip an insn that could throw if dead exceptions can be deleted. (insn_live_p): Likewise, do not return true in that case. * dce.c (can_alter_cfg): New flag. (deletable_insn_p): Do not return false for an insn that can throw if the CFG can be altered and dead exceptions can be deleted. (init_dce): Set can_alter_cfg to false for fast DCE, true otherwise. * dse.c (scan_insn): Use !insn_nothrow_p in lieu of insn_could_throw_ predicate. Do not preserve an insn that could throw if dead exceptions can be deleted. * function.h (struct function): Add can_delete_dead_exceptions flag. * function.c (allocate_struct_function): Set it. * lto-streamer-in.c (input_struct_function_base): Stream it. * lto-streamer-out.c (input_struct_function_base): Likewise. * tree-ssa-dce.c (mark_stmt_if_obviously_necessary): Do not mark a statement that could throw as necessary if dead exceptions can be deleted. ada/ * gcc-interface/misc.c (gnat_init_options_struct): Set opts->x_flag_delete_dead_exceptions to 1.
